UNIVERSAL EPROM PROG (smd ver1).pub
Transkript
UNIVERSAL EPROM PROG (smd ver1).pub
(Willeprom) EPROM PROGRAMMER tro ni k. co m UNIVERSAL EPROM PROGRAMMER EYLÜL 2000 Update 09-2003 Update 02-2004 64K/4MB’A KADAR 32 PIN EPROMLAR ( ADAPTÖR EKLERİ İLE ÇOK YÖNLÜ ÇALIŞMAYA AÇIK) PROGRAMLAMAYA GİRİŞ ww w. de ni ze le k Arabirim kartıyla birlikte verilen program CD ROM’u bilgisayarınıza yerleştirip,sabit diskinize kopyalayınız.Uygun şekilde masa üstünden kolayca erişebilmek için bir kısayol oluşturunuz. Kurulumu tamamladıktan sonra bilgisayarınızı kapatıp karta bağlayacağınız 25’li LPT1 printer çıkış kablosunu bilgisayarınızın LPT1 veya LPT2 (Paralel port) soketine takınız. Karta ek adaptör ile 15 VDC gerilim veriniz. Bu esnada power led’i (kırmızı) ışıldayacaktır. (Uyarı: Bilgisayar port bağlantılarının bilgisayar kapalı iken yapılması gereklidir. Aksi durumda hem cihaza hem de bilgisayarınıza zarar verebilirsiniz! Profosyoneller için bu uyarı geçersizdir. Şimdi bilgisayarınızı açıp programa geçiniz ve monitörünüzden pencereleri izleyiniz. Programı çalıştırmadıysanız üç adet led, program çalışırken sadece ilgili ledler ışıldayacaktır.Kart ile okuma veya yazma yapıldığında (türüne göre seçim yapılacak) program otomatik olarak dip switch konfıgürasyonunu gösterecektir. Bunu şekle bakarak kart üzerinde dikkatle aynen uygulayınız. On konumundakiler switch üzerinde on konumuna alınacak. (On konumu yukarıdaki pencerede işaretlenmiştir)Yalnız baskılı devre üzerindeki bu yon resimdekinin tersi olup hata yapılmamalıdır.Kullanıcıların en çok bu konuda hata yaptıklarını defalarca gördük! Dip switch üzerinde mutlaka on yazısı vardır.Buna dikkat edilmelidir. Çiplerin prefix (ön ek)'lerine göre klikleyiniz Örnek olarak: Ön seçimden sonra 27010 Eprom'unun seçimi (sağda) görülen şekilde olacaktır.Bundan sonra ana menüde bu çipe uygun Dip switch anahtarlarının durumu otomatik olarak belirlenecek ve devre üzerinde bulunan kısımda da aynısı ön set edilecektir.Soket üzerinde Çipinizin nasıl yerleştireleceği konusunda menüdeki resim size yardımcı olacaktır. Unutulmamalıdır ki uygun çip seçimi ile mevcut çipinizle devre arasında uygun bağlantı kurulabilecektir. V2 REV4 (SMD PCB) KULLANIM ALANLARI BİLGİSAYAR BIOSLARI GSM TELEFON DIGITAL UYDU ALICILARI TELSİZ TV-VIDEO-DVD PLAY STATION VCD-RADIOMEDIKAL TEKNİK SERVİS • DOS VE WINDOWS UYGULAMALI • WINDOWS TÜRKÇE MENÜ • KOLAY ÖNSET • HEX VE BINARY PROGRAM SAKLAMA • PRINTER PORT ERİŞİMLİ • AMATÖR VE PROFOSYONEL UYGULAMALAR • KOLAY OKUMA VE YAZMA MODU • ADAPTÖR EKİ İLE ÇEŞİTLİ BACAK YAPISINA UYARLANABİLME tro ni k. co m UNIVERSAL EPROM PROGRAMLAYICI Seçilen çip kodu Dip switch yönüne ve ON konumuna dikkat ediniz. (Kullanıcılar bu konuda tam ters işlem yapmaktadırlar) le k Tampon konumunda ise çiplerin içeriği (hex-ascıı ) kodları görünecektir. ww w. de ni ze Aygıt (device) bolümü şeçildiğinde mevcut bulunan çiplerin indeksi görüntülenir Değişmeyecek! 1-Dosyaların transferleri için kullanılacaktır. 2-Okunmuş çiplerin (seçilen formata göre) hardiske veya diskete kaydı için kullanılacaktır. 3-Ekrandaki bilgilerin silinmesi içindir.(farklı çipler yüklendiğinde enson yeni hex görünümünü sağlamak içindir.) 4-Çiplerin içeriğini okumak için kullanılacak (READ) 5-Kayıttan sonra tampon (buffer) dosyasının kayıtlı bulunan çip üzerinden tekrar olarak doğrulamasını sağlar (verify) Bu opsiyon genelde kullanmayabilir çünkü yazılım otomatık olarak kayıt sonrası doğrulamayı kendiliğinden yapmaktadır. 6-Çip içeriğinin, dolu veya boş olup olmadığını kontrol eder. 7-Eprom çiplerinin ID (tanıtım) bilgilerinin okunmasını sağlar. 8-Yazma (Write) komutu 9-Silme (Erase) komutu .Flash çiplerin mutlaka kayıt öncesi silinmesi gerekir. Kısa indeks menüsü V2 REV4 Okunmuş dosyaların buffer (tampon) ekran görünümü Page 3 UYGULAMA ÖRNEKLERİ tro ni k. co m Yanda örnek olarak 27C serisinden olan 27C512 tipinde bir epromun nasıl seçilmiş olduğu gösterilmektedir.Alta ise Epromun Zif sokete yerleşimi ve Dipswitch pozısyonu görülmektedir. ww w. de ni ze le k Epromlar genel olarak 512 kb'den sonra 1MB-2Mb -4Mb (ve daha fazla) değerlerde üretilmektedirler.Fakat çoğu çip üreticileri suffix kodlarını (son ek) Değişik formatta çip üzerine yazmaktadırlar.Kb değerlerle çakışması halınde çiplere sağlıklı bilgiler yazdırılabilir.Kafa karıştırır gibi olsa da 1-2-4-8-16 Mb olarak üretildiklerini de bilmemiz gerekir.Çiplerinizi seçerken bu rakamlara dikkat edilmesi gerekmektedir. Örnek olarak son ekinde (suffix) 1 rakamı olan (1mb) çipleri diğer farklı çip konfıgrasyonlarında da deneyerek sonuç alabilirsiniz.Yani çip üzerindeki rakamın tamamı yazılım üzerinde uyuşuyor olsa bile yazma veya silme sorunu olabilmektedir.Fakat bu diğer bölümlerin herhangibiri kullanılmak suretiyle kolayca çözümlenebilmektedir. Deneyler göstermiştir ki Farkli çip üreticileri ve farklı bilgisayarlarda verilen değerler tam karşılık olarak gelmeyebilir.Hatta bilgisayar portlarındakı farklı gerilimler de buna önemli ölçüde etki etmektedir.Bazı PC'lerde ise belkide hiçbir ayara gerek kalmayabilir.Çözüm ise PC'nizin Setup ayarlarından ECP-FSP ve diğer konumları (sabırla) değiştirerek uygun duruma getirmektir.Bu bazen kişinin 2. veya 3. bilgisayar denemesine kadar gidebilir.Fakat kişinin sorunun yine kendi PC setup'ları ile ilgili olduğuna ikna olabilecektir. Yazı sonunda test edilen çipler listesi (Üretici markaları ile beraber verilmektedir.) 1Mb yerine, 2Mb veya 4 Mb Eprom seçeneği seçilmiş olur ise tabii ki sonuç olumsuz olacaktır.Hem dip switch konumu yanlış olacak hemde konfıgürasyon uyuşmayacaktır.Bu konuda kullanıcıların dikkat etmesi gereklidir. Atmel ve Winbond serileri Bios kullanıcılarının en sık rastlayacağı çipler kategorisinde yer almaktadır.(yukarıda ) Sonuç olarak elinizde bulunan bu aygıtla %100'lük performanslara erişmek olanaklıdır.Bu da Endüstriyel cıhazlar yanında (ekonomik oluşu ile beraber) hiç de küçümsenmeyecek bir sonuçtur. Ayrı bir Atmel seçeneği Burada yine 1 mb ve 2mb epromlara çözüm getirilebilmektedir. 29/39/49 serilerinde bulunan 64 kb 128kb-512kb-1mb-2mb-4mb sıralamalarına bir örnek. V2 REV4 Page 4 HATA MESAJLARI tro ni k. co m Hata mesajları çok çeşitli olmakla birlikte en sık rastlanılanlara değinilecektir.Şöyleki bir adaptör voltaj sorunu veya kablodakı bir sorun zaten elektroniğin temel hatalarından birkaçıdır.Çiplerin arızalı olması durumunda da hata mesajları menüde eksik olmayacaktır.(Bozulmuş epromlarda hiçbir kayıt yapılamaz!) Bu tip sorunları asgarıye indirmek için , kaliteli ve bilinen güç kaynaklarını tercih ediniz.Keza 25 pinli port kablolarında da aynı hassasiyetin gösterilmesi gerekir.Aklınıza soru işareti (?) olarak gelebilecek herşeyi dijital mantık ile çözmeye çalışınız. Yanı olumsuz ekipmanları 2.veya 3. İle değiştirerek yaptığınız uygulama ve sonuçlarını not alarak kendikendinize bir yargıya varınız.Bu üretici ile telefon diyaloğunuzu de asgarıye indirecektir. Olası hardware hatasının düzeltilmesi için üretici teknik servisi ile temas kurmanız zaman kaybını önlemiş olacaktır. Bunun dışındakı problemlere kişi zamanla edineceği deneyimlerle kolay çözümler üretebilir. Çipleri soket üzerine kesinlikle ters takmayınız! (Çipiniz derhal bozulur!) Port kablolarının mutlak surette kaliteli türden olmasına özen gösteriniz Flash epromlar mutlaka silme komutundan sonra kayıt konumuna alınmalıdır ! ww w. de ni ze le k Uygun Parametreler seçildiğinde , (Epromlar için ) elektronik kimlik görünümü de sağlıklı olacaktır. 24C serileri için yerleşim planı (yalnız SMD modeli için geçerlidir) DC GÜÇ KAYNAĞI Lütfen okumadan cıhaza gerilim vermeyiniz! Güç kaynağı olarak minimum 15 Volt verebilen DC güç kaynağı kullanılacaktır. 100 mA verebilmesi yeterli gelmektedir. Devrenin Eprom ile beraber harcadığı akım (normalde) 50mA cıvarındadır. Adaptör voltu 18 veya 20Volt olarak da seçilebilir.Bu durumda arta kalan voltaj ısı olarak dışarıya atılacaktır.Güç kaynağı giriş soketinin dış metal gövdesi şası (toprak)potansiyelinde olup orta uç + uç olarak seçilecektir.Bu polarıte yönüne adaptör çıkışını ölçerek tam emin olduktan sonra devreye gerilim uygulayınız. Ters bağlaşımda koruma diodu devreye girecek ve devreye gerilim ulaşamayacaktır. Eprom programlayıcının PCB görünümü KABLO Devre için Printer port kablosu olarak 25 pın (kablodan kabloya) iki ucu erkek tıp konnektör kullanılacaktır. Uzun metrajlı kablo kullanılması hatalara yol açabilir. PLCC32 Adaptor’lerin kullanılmasına bir örnek (üstte) 25C ve 93C serileri baskılı devrenin sağ üst köşesinde yer almaktadır. DİĞER SERİLER (PIC VE EEPROMLAR) 93CXX 24CXX 24C serilerindeki Eepromlar arzuya göre seçilip programlanabilir. Dip sw yönleri tamamı off konumunda olacak. PIC tro ni k. co m 93C serisi eepromlar listesi Marka ve parametre seçimine dikkat edilmesi tavsiye edilir. (Bu seçeneklerde üst version program kullanmak bazen olumsuz olabilir) Dip anahtarlarının yönu bu çiplerin seçiminde de tamamen off konumunda olacaktır. ww w. de ni ze le k PIC Programlamaya geçildiğinde Bilgisayarınızı kapatıp ilk bu programı aktıf hale getirerek kullanınız. Aksı halde PIC'e kayıt yapılamaz. Çok güncel bir yapıya sahip olan PIC'ler arasından ençok kullanılanlar seçilmiştir.( 16C84 'ün üretimi artık yapılmayacağı duyuruldu) Baskılı devre bordu üzerinde bulunan kendine ait sokete (yöne dikkat)yerleştireceğiniz çiplerinize derlenmiş dosyalarınızın kaydını yazar veya okuyabilirsiniz. Kod koruma bölümünü Evet seçerseniz yaptığınız kayıt başkaları tarafından deşifre edilemeyecektir (Code Protect) Bunu yanlişlıkla yaparsanız doğal olarak çip üzerine kayıt almayacaktır.Silme komutu ile durum normale döner .Tabii bu durumda üzerine tekrar dosyayı kayıt etmelisiniz. 12508 ve 12C509 Pıc'leri için de kayıt aynı yöntemle yapılır .Fakat tek kötü yönü bu çiplere sadece bir kez kayıt yapılabilmesi.Olası bir hatada asla geriye dönemezsiniz. Bu çiplerle çalışırken satıcınızdan bir avuç çip ve oadanızdaki çöp kovasına yakın oturmanız tavsiye edilir. Menüdeki diğer parametreleri yazılımcılar zaten çok iyi bilmektedirler.COPY yapacak olanlar ise zahmet etmeden zaten dosya yüklendiğinde parametrelerin kendiliğinden yerli yerinde olduğunu gözlemleyeceklerdir. 12CXX soketi ayrıca olmayıp 16FXX soketinin 1.Pin'ine yerleştirilecektir.8.pin ise 16. Pin'e denk düşecek NOT:Bu çipte yazılım sorunları yaşanabilmektedir. Sayfada açıklaması yapılmayıp yazılım içinde yeralan çipler ise ek adaptörler ile aktıf duruma gelebilmektedir.Bu konuda istekler olduğunda dELAb sizlere yardımcı olacaktir. www.delab.us www.denizelektronik.com
Benzer belgeler
ezoflash programmer 4v3
mA verebilmesi yeterli gelmektedir. Devrenin Eprom ile beraber harcadığı akım (normalde) 50mA cıvarındadır. Adaptör voltu 18 veya 20Volt olarak da seçilebilir.Bu durumda arta kalan voltaj ısı olara...
DetaylıLAP-TOP PIC PROGRAMMER
üzerine kayıt komutu ile gönderilebilir.Bu tip hazır dosyalarda yazılımcı tarafından kod koruma program içine yazılmış ise eğer siz programı ekrana aldığınızda otomatık olarak belirtilen ikonlar ke...
Detaylı